Job Qualifications
- High school diploma, GED or equivalent vocational training with job-related courses preferred
- Minimum 1 year line/prep cook experience in fine dining restaurant/luxury resort/private club
- Ability to chop, prepare, or cook food items and a familiarity with a range of cooking techniques
- Understand and abide by all federal, state, and local food safety and sanitation regulations, including state required food handler certificates
Job Duties
- Assist in set up/preparation of culinary program for the season and on a daily basis
- Set up assigned station with predetermined mise en place to ready station for service
- Prepare food items for any and all food outlets according to designated menus/recipes by Executive Chef
- Prepare food items for members/guests as requested using quality predetermined method in a timely/confident manner
- Cook all food according to recipes, quality/presentation standards and food preparation check lists
- Demonstrate safe/proper use of all equipment at all times, checking to ensure correctness of temperatures of appliances/food
- Demonstrate proper-efficient production of food items to achieve maximum productivity and reduce kitchen waste
- Monitor all food quality/presentation while preparing food
- Stock/rotate food
- Alert Sous Chef of low inventory items
- Work line, salad station, prep station, and any other stations as needed
- Control pace of food orders/set tone for ticket flowing process
- Peeling and chopping vegetables
- Preparing cuts of meat, filleting and deboning fish
- Putting away deliveries of stock
- Clean stations and equipment, and other areas as necessary
